Skip to Content

Odoo For Music School Management

Effortless Class Management, Attendance Tracking, and Reporting for Music Schools

Contact us

Music Art School Management Odoo Apps

Music Academy Management Odoo Apps useful application for managing a music school. With this app, users can efficiently manage classes and lessons, track attendance, and generate invoices based on attended classes. Additionally, the app allows users to manage student and teacher details, as well as instrument and service information. The ability to generate repeat rules for classes and lessons makes scheduling easier and more efficient. The app also provides a convenient way to print attendance reports in PDF format, making it easy to share information with stakeholders. Overall, the Music School Management Odoo App seems like a valuable tool for anyone looking to streamline the management of a music school.

  

Manage Students or Teachers Details

Effortlessly organize and oversee comprehensive details regarding both students and educators, ensuring that all relevant information is easily accessible and manageable.

 

Manage Classes or Lessons

Effectively plan, organize, and oversee music classes and lessons to ensure a smooth and enriching learning experience for all participants.

 

Manage Instrument Details

Maintain a comprehensive inventory of musical instruments along with the various services associated with them.

 

Track Student Attendance

Keep a detailed record of student attendance for every individual lesson and monitor their participation closely to ensure engagement and accountability.

 

Generate Student Invoices

Generate invoices automatically for students, taking into account the specific classes and lessons they have attended throughout the term.

 

Print Attendance Reports

Effortlessly generate and print detailed attendance reports in PDF format, allowing you to specify and select the desired date ranges for your records.

Benefits of Music School Management

All-in-One Platform

Manage students, teachers, classes, lessons, instruments, and services in one system.

Efficient Class & Lesson Scheduling 

Easily organize lessons with repeat rules to simplify scheduling.

Accurate Attendance Tracking 

Track and record student attendance with the option to generate detailed reports.

Automated Invoicing

Generate invoices automatically based on attended classes and lessons.

Better Reporting & Sharing

Print and share attendance reports in PDF format for smooth communication with stakeholders.

Benefits of Music School Management

Students Menu


Goto Music School -> Configuration -> Students menu, Users can create students and enter all the details of student.

Students Menu

Instruments Menu


Goto Music School -> Configuration -> Instruments menu, User can easily manage instruments of the school.

Instruments Menu

Teachers Menu



Teachers Menu

Services Menu


Goto Music School -> Configuration -> Services menu, User can easily manage required services of the school.

Services Menu

Classes Dashboard



Classes Dashboard

Create Music Classes


User can create or add classes in the music school.

User can fill the details like name of the class and period of the class then select teacher, service and instrument also set frequency of the class like there are 3 options, Daily, Weekly and Monthly.

If user repeat the class on a daily basis, class will be repeated daily.

Create Music Classes

 
If user repeat the class on a weekly basis, class will be repeated based on selected days.

class on a weekly basis

 
If user repeat the class on a monthly basis, class will be repeated based on selected dates.

class on a monthly basis


Add Lessons on the Class


Under Law Here select the days and repeat the class on a weekly basis, User have to click on 'ADD LESSONS' button to add lessons for class

Add Lessons on the Class

Add Lessons Wizard


User can see the class name in wizard and click on 'Add a line' option to add or select students.

Add Lessons Wizard

Add Lessons Wizard

After selected students click on 'ADD LESSON' button on wizard.

ADD LESSON


Generated Required Lessons


User can see automatically generate the required lessons based on the repetition then click on 'START' button to start the class.

Generated Required Lessons

Started the Class



Started the Class

Lessons Menu


Goto Music School -> Configuration -> Lessons menu, User can manage lessons of the class.

Lessons Menu

Start Lesson


User have to click on 'START' button to starting lesson.

Start Lesson

Complete Lesson


User have to click on 'COMPLETE' button to completed the lesson.

Complete Lesson

Complete Lesson

Kanban View of Lessons



Kanban View of Lessons

Student Attendance Menu


Goto Music School -> Student Attendance menu, User can see the list view of student attendance.

Student Attendance Menu

Graph View of Student Attendance



Graph View of Student Attendance

Kanban View of Student Attendance



Kanban View of Student Attendance

Pivot View of Student Attendance



Pivot View of Student Attendance

Create Invoice of the Class


User can click on 'CREATE INVOICE' button to create an invoice for the students and according to the number of lessons they are attended, Invoices are created.

Create Invoice of the Class

 
User can see the invoice for particular student with attended number of lessons.

particular student with attended number of lessons


Music Class Report Menu


Goto Music School -> Reporting -> Music Class Reporting menu to generate student attendance report.

Music Class Report Menu

Student Attendance Report



Student Attendance Report

Why Choose Our Odoo Music School Management Module?

Our Odoo Music School Management Module streamlines the operations of music academies by centralizing student and teacher details, lesson scheduling, attendance tracking, and invoicing. With features like instrument management, automated reports, and repeat class rules, it ensures smooth administration, better resource utilization, and improved learning experiences for both students and teachers.

Also Explore Odoo eLearning to create, manage, and deliver online courses in a structured way. It helps you train employees or customers easily with engaging content, progress tracking, and a smooth learning experience.